Output e9704eafaae04d21cf13f3fa85a34dcb8015a652e5444dd83d61e1833262bb2d:1

value
6585894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 33d85d0f052139ae816699f3cadc18e23919e0d8 OP_EQUALVERIFY OP_CHECKSIG
address
15j8ez3rPsP39znc8gcCtRtVbHPBRwmMRL
transaction
e9704eafaae04d21cf13f3fa85a34dcb8015a652e5444dd83d61e1833262bb2d
confirmations
520234
spent
true